If you’re exploring CBSE schools in South Bangalore, Capitol Public School in JP Nagar often comes up as a practical, mid-range option. This summary brings together verified details, parent feedback, and fee information to help you decide if it fits your child’s needs.
- ✦Part of the Capitol Group of Institutions with campuses in JP Nagar, Jakkur, and Mysuru.
- ✦Focus on lab-based learning and participation in Olympiads and national-level competitions.
- ✦Moderate fee structure compared to premium CBSE schools in Bangalore.

Fees & Admissions
| Class / Category | Fee (₹)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| I – V | ₹65,000 | As per official 2024–25 PDF |
| VI – IX | ₹70,000 | As per official 2024–25 PDF |
| Application Fee | ₹500 | Listed on Edustoke |
| Admission Fee | ₹50,000 | Third-party listing; confirm directly |
| Transport Fee | ₹20,000–₹30,000 | Depends on route |
• The 2024–25 fee PDF (dated Jan 2025) is the most recent official document.
• Older 2022 fee PDF (₹56,000) is outdated.
• Third-party listings showing ₹1,00,000+ likely include one-time or admission charges.
• Always confirm the latest fee structure directly with the school office.
Admission Process for Interested Parents
Admission Form
Available on the school website (AdmissionForm2024.pdf)
Timeline
- 1.Forms usually open between October and January for the next academic year.
Process
- 1.Submit the filled form to the administrative office.
- 2.For pre-primary, an observation/interaction session is scheduled.
- 3.Admission receipt includes fields for tuition, admission, and computer fees (filled at office).
Documents Required
- 1.Birth certificate, Aadhar (child & parents), photos, previous school TC (if applicable), proof of residence, and medical details.
Eligibility
Follows standard CBSE age norms; confirm cut-off dates each year.
What Parents Say
Aggregated from parent reviews across platforms. Ask these questions during your school visit.
Academics
Positives
Parents appreciate experienced teachers and focused academics. Some mention good mentorship during board years.
Watch out for
A few reviews mention teacher bias and inconsistent teaching quality.
Ask: Ask about teacher qualifications and how the school supports weaker students.
Fees & Value
Positives
Many parents feel the fees are reasonable compared to other CBSE schools in the area.
Watch out for
Some parents report unclear donation or one-time charges and describe the management as “money-minded.”
Ask: Request a written breakdown of all fees, including one-time and refundable components.
Infrastructure
Positives
The school offers labs, library, sports ground, and CCTV coverage.
Watch out for
Hygiene issues, especially in washrooms, have been mentioned in older reviews.
Ask: Visit the campus and check washrooms, classrooms, and safety measures yourself.
Management & Communication
Positives
Admission forms and processes are available online, which is convenient.
Watch out for
Several parents report poor communication and unhelpful management interactions.
Ask: Ask how the school handles parent grievances and communication updates.
